Mutatis Mutandis

Latin: 'with the necessary changes.' Used when applying a rule, principle, or provision to a new situation that requires minor modifications to fit the changed circumstances.

Etymology: Latin: 'things being changed that need to be changed' · Category: Latin Legal Terms
